Mosiah 5:11 - 5:15

Mosiah 5:11 And I would that ye should remember also, that this is the name that I said I should give unto you that never should be blotted out, except it be through transgression; therefore, take heed that ye do not transgress, that the name be not blotted out of your hearts.

Always remember, that this name of Christ is the only way to obtain salvation. If you fall away, the name will slip away from your hearts. You will eventually forget that you have taken upon yourselves this name and you will find yourselves beyond his influence in time if you persist.

Mosiah 5:12 I say unto you, I would that ye should remember to retain the name written always in your hearts, that ye are not found on the left hand of God, but that ye hear and know the voice by which ye shall be called, and also, the name by which he shall call you.

By taking upon yourselves this name, you will remember by whom you are called to salvation and the way to obtain it. Keep that name always before you so you will not slip away from salvation because you have made not effort to keep it in your hearts.

Mosiah 5:13 For how knoweth a man the master whom he has not served, and who is a stranger unto him, and is far from the thoughts and intents of his heart?

If you do not keep that name before you at all times, you will not know how salvation is obtain. You will naturally be drawn to some other way of live. You will then find yourselves living another life style that is not the gospel and not longer understand who Christ is or what He was striving to help you to become. You will be on your own and will find yourself and outsider to God.

Mosiah 5:14 And again, doth a man take an ass which belongeth to his neighbor, and keep him? I say unto you, Nay; he will not even suffer that he shall feed among his flocks, but will drive him away, and cast him out. I say unto you, that even so shall it be among you if ye know not the name by which ye are called.

This rejection by God of those who will not take upon themselves the name of Christ is compared to the common problem of animals of one’s neighbor coming in to feel on the grain that is meant for your flocks. That stray is immediately driven out away. So if you do not take upon yourselves the name of Christ, you will be driven out.

Mosiah 5:15 Therefore, I would that ye should be steadfast and immovable, always abounding in good works, that Christ, the Lord God Omnipotent, may seal you his, that you may be brought to heaven, that ye may have everlasting salvation and eternal life, through the wisdom, and power, and justice, and mercy of him who created all things, in heaven and in earth, who is God above all. Amen.

The bottom line is this: do good to your neighbor and your families. Doing so will put you in a position to be sealed to Christ, that you might be able to enter the Celestial Kingdom and enjoy the eternal joy that comes from service and the ability to help others progress in the eternities forever.
